Types of Drug Detox Programs in Ramah, Colorado

There are a lot of different types of alcohol and drug detox centers. The program you start in, therefore, will greatly depend on the drugs you used to abuse and the types of the symptoms of withdrawal you are likely to experience when you stop using these drugs.

Consider the following:

1. Inpatient Detoxification

In many instances, you will find that residential or inpatient detox in Ramah is the most highly recommended type of treatment because it can help you avoid relapse as well as ensure that you have 24/7 medical care, oversight, and management in instances that your withdrawal becomes a medical emergency.

Today, the majority of detoxification services are provided on an inpatient or residential basis. Once you graduate successfully from these programs, you may also transfer to another alcohol and drug abuse rehabilitation facility if the center you detoxed in does not offer treatment services.

2. Outpatient Detoxification

Outpatient detoxification is hardly ever recommended. However, it may be an option if your addiction is not ass severe, if finances are a problem, or if you can't neglect work and home because of your day to day responsibilities. Either way, this form of addiction rehabilitation will need you to check-in regularly with the detox team.

You might also be administered medication through prescriptions or at a methadone clinic when you need more intensive care while going through the detox process. In the end, however, outpatient detoxification rarely works quite as effectively as that offered on an inpatient or residential basis.

Overall, certain intoxicating substances might come with some physiological symptoms of withdrawal but also cause more intense psychological withdrawal. These include cocaine, methamphetamines, and other stimulants. In these instances, the detoxification process should include a therapeutic and psychiatric component to ensure more ideal management and care for these psychological conditions. You may also receive 24/7 oversight to make sure that you do not harm yourself or other people.
